I was using version 6.70, radio is a FT-1000, serial interface, DOS 6.22,
128M RAM, DVP board.

40 meters was the area that I was a bit frustrated  (It is one of my
favorite bands, even during SSB). If a spot came in with a QSX and I went to
grab it. My radio went to CW mode. The other bands had this happen as well,
there were many  DX stations operating out of our band, but listening up.
Of course 40 & 80 are the most common, but also seen on some of the other
bands. BTW, I had more QSOs on 40 than on 20!!

In sending spots, the program does not read the QSX freq and forces me to
manually entering it. This made it tough to S&P and send spots quickly. I
try to send as many spots as possible when in S&P mode. I am not a spot
sucker, I try to send close to as many as I use.....
